class YahooFinanceCSVData(feed.CSVDataBase):
    '''
    Parses pre-downloaded Yahoo CSV Data Feeds (or locally generated if they
    comply to the Yahoo format)

    Specific parameters:

      - ``dataname``: The filename to parse or a file-like object

      - ``reverse`` (default: ``False``)

        It is assumed that locally stored files have already been reversed
        during the download process

      - ``adjclose`` (default: ``True``)

        Whether to use the dividend/split adjusted close and adjust all
        values according to it.

      - ``adjvolume`` (default: ``True``)

        Do also adjust ``volume`` if ``adjclose`` is also ``True``

      - ``round`` (default: ``True``)

        Whether to round the values to a specific number of decimals after
        having adjusted the close

      - ``roundvolume`` (default: ``0``)

        Round the resulting volume to the given number of decimals after having
        adjusted it

      - ``decimals`` (default: ``2``)

        Number of decimals to round to

      - ``swapcloses`` (default: ``False``)

        [2018-11-16] It would seem that the order of *close* and *adjusted
        close* is now fixed. The parameter is retained, in case the need to
        swap the columns again arose.

    '''

class YahooFinanceData(YahooFinanceCSVData):
    '''
    Executes a direct download of data from Yahoo servers for the given time
    range.

    Specific parameters (or specific meaning):

      - ``dataname``

        The ticker to download ('YHOO' for Yahoo own stock quotes)

      - ``proxies``

        A dict indicating which proxy to go through for the download as in
        {'http': 'http://myproxy.com'} or {'http': 'http://127.0.0.1:8080'}

      - ``period``

        The timeframe to download data in. Pass 'w' for weekly and 'm' for
        monthly.

      - ``reverse``

        [2018-11-16] The latest incarnation of Yahoo online downloads returns
        the data in the proper order. The default value of ``reverse`` for the
        online download is therefore set to ``False``

      - ``adjclose``

        Whether to use the dividend/split adjusted close and adjust all values
        according to it.

      - ``urlhist``

        The url of the historical quotes in Yahoo Finance used to gather a
        ``crumb`` authorization cookie for the download

      - ``urldown``

        The url of the actual download server

      - ``retries``

        Number of times (each) to try to get a ``crumb`` cookie and download
        the data

      '''
